About this service

Handyman assistance for seniors is centered on home modifications that support independent living. This might involve installing motion-sensor lighting, lever-style door handles, or shower seats. These professional adjustments help maintain a safe environment as needs change over time.

What are some red flags when hiring a handyman in New York?

Watch out for handymen who are hesitant to provide a written estimate or ask for full payment upfront. Unprofessional communication, lack of clear identification, or pressure to commit immediately can also be warning signs. Always ensure they are licensed and insured for your peace of mind.
